// this is a copy of defines in svx/inc/escpitem.hxx
#define DFLT_ESC_PROP 58
#define DFLT_ESC_AUTO_SUPER 101
#define DFLT_ESC_AUTO_SUB -101
///////////////////////////////////////////////////////////////////////////////
//
// class XMLEscapementPropHdl
//
XMLEscapementPropHdl::~XMLEscapementPropHdl()
{
// nothing to do
}
sal_Bool XMLEscapementPropHdl::importXML( const OUString& rStrImpValue, uno::Any& rValue, const SvXMLUnitConverter& ) const
{
sal_Int16 nVal;
SvXMLTokenEnumerator aTokens( rStrImpValue );
OUString aToken;
if( ! aTokens.getNextToken( aToken ) )
return sal_False;
if( IsXMLToken( aToken, XML_ESCAPEMENT_SUB ) )
{
nVal = DFLT_ESC_AUTO_SUB;
}
else if( IsXMLToken( aToken, XML_ESCAPEMENT_SUPER ) )
{
nVal = DFLT_ESC_AUTO_SUPER;
}
else
{
sal_Int32 nNewEsc;
if( !SvXMLUnitConverter::convertPercent( nNewEsc, aToken ) )
return sal_False;
nVal = (sal_Int16) nNewEsc;
}
rValue <<= nVal;
return sal_True;
}
sal_Bool XMLEscapementPropHdl::exportXML( OUString& rStrExpValue, const uno::Any& rValue, const SvXMLUnitConverter& ) const
{
sal_Int32 nValue = 0;
OUStringBuffer aOut;
if( rValue >>= nValue )
{
if( nValue == DFLT_ESC_AUTO_SUPER )
{
aOut.append( GetXMLToken(XML_ESCAPEMENT_SUPER) );
}
else if( nValue == DFLT_ESC_AUTO_SUB )
{
aOut.append( GetXMLToken(XML_ESCAPEMENT_SUB) );
}
else
{
SvXMLUnitConverter::convertPercent( aOut, nValue );
}
}
rStrExpValue = aOut.makeStringAndClear();
return sal_True;
}
///////////////////////////////////////////////////////////////////////////////
//
// class XMLEscapementHeightPropHdl
//
XMLEscapementHeightPropHdl::~XMLEscapementHeightPropHdl()
{
// nothing to do
}
sal_Bool XMLEscapementHeightPropHdl::importXML( const OUString& rStrImpValue, uno::Any& rValue, const SvXMLUnitConverter& ) const
{
if( IsXMLToken( rStrImpValue, XML_CASEMAP_SMALL_CAPS ) )
return sal_False;
SvXMLTokenEnumerator aTokens( rStrImpValue );
OUString aToken;
if( ! aTokens.getNextToken( aToken ) )
return sal_False;
sal_Int8 nProp;
if( aTokens.getNextToken( aToken ) )
{
sal_Int32 nNewProp;
if( !SvXMLUnitConverter::convertPercent( nNewProp, aToken ) )
return sal_False;
nProp = (sal_Int8)nNewProp;
}
else
{
sal_Int32 nEscapementPosition=0;
if( SvXMLUnitConverter::convertPercent( nEscapementPosition, aToken ) && nEscapementPosition==0 )
nProp = 100; //if escapement position is zero and no escapement height is given the default height should be 100percent and not something smaller (#i91800#)
else
nProp = (sal_Int8) DFLT_ESC_PROP;
}
rValue <<= nProp;
return sal_True;
}
sal_Bool XMLEscapementHeightPropHdl::exportXML( OUString& rStrExpValue, const uno::Any& rValue, const SvXMLUnitConverter& ) const
{
OUStringBuffer aOut( rStrExpValue );
sal_Int32 nValue = 0;
if( rValue >>= nValue )
{
if( rStrExpValue.getLength() )
aOut.append( sal_Unicode(' '));
SvXMLUnitConverter::convertPercent( aOut, nValue );
}
rStrExpValue = aOut.makeStringAndClear();
return rStrExpValue.getLength() != 0;
}
